## Onboarding: Farebranch Rules Engine

Plugin authors integrate with Farebranch by registering fee rules against the evaluation API. Rules are sandboxed; they cannot perform network calls directly. All rate-table lookups go through the host, which validates your plugin manifest at load time. Your local env file must include the signing credential the host uses to verify manifests, set on the next line.

secret setting of bajef-fajof: COURIER_KEY3=76c

Ticket: Staging env misconfigured for Siftgate bloom filter

The bloom layer in front of the Pellet KV store is rejecting all lookups in staging because the env file was copied from the dev template without credentials. False-positive tuning values are fine; only the auth line is missing. To unblock the weekly demo, the Pellet admission secret must be set on the following line.

env line for yaguf-fajop: LEDGER_TOKEN13=fb08984397349

Step 6: Configure rate limiting on the Kestrelgate internal API gateway. Each upstream service gets a token bucket defined in the limits table; defaults are 200 requests per minute per caller. Exceeding the limit returns a 429 with a retry hint header. Before restarting the gateway, confirm your service's bucket row exists, since missing rows fall back to the strictest tier. The gateway reads these limit definitions from the database reachable via the connection string below.

replica DSN, tawef-hahap: mysql://eliix_svc:FiIC0jz@db-394a.lumiclabs.internal:5432/holius